Transaction ff58f794b10236d2145a0956a4422bb776c19579d6c01fe4e22c74ee1baf8c90

1 Input
2 Outputs
  • ff58f794b10236d2145a0956a4422bb776c19579d6c01fe4e22c74ee1baf8c90:0
  • value  495827
    address  3LfBKFD1GG6Lw2pUNVgKR8v9AcmYSSiMxn
  • ff58f794b10236d2145a0956a4422bb776c19579d6c01fe4e22c74ee1baf8c90:1
  • value  18609136
    address  18G9eMVdUq4FbKz22A86vPGuSePNUBC1oF